Due to high demand The Alfred’s P.A.R.T.Y. (Prevent Alcohol and Risk- Related Trauma in Youth) program are presenting an event on Tuesday 19th November so that older youth, their families and friends can be better informed about the consequences of risk-taking behaviour.
Due to philanthropic support from the Highland Foundation our team is able to deliver this 2.5-hour program which will run from 5:30pm to 8:00pm. It will include a combination of video, demonstrations and live presentations with Alfred Health clinicians, first responders, allied Health and a past Alfred trauma patient.
The program operates on the principle of proactive education, providing participants with real-life scenarios and interactive experiences that underscore the importance of safety, responsible decision-making, and the consequences of risky behaviours. By addressing issues such as impaired driving, substance abuse, and injury prevention head-on, we strive to educate young Victorians to make positive choices and avoid potentially life-threatening situations.
Visits to the trauma clinical areas will be included (patient/workload dependent on the night)
